The Role of Shell and Tube Heat Exchangers

The primary purpose of a shell and tube heat exchanger is to facilitate efficient heat transfer between two fluids with different temperatures—without allowing them to mix. This separation poses unique challenges for cleaning since any cross-contamination of the fluids must be avoided to preserve operational integrity.

Our Shell and Tube Heat Exchanger Cleaning Process

Carolina PEC specializes in cleaning systematic shell and tube heat exchangers, ensuring optimal performance and extended equipment life. Our multi-step cleaning regimen includes:

  1. High-Temperature Oxidation: Initial removal of gross contaminants through high-temperature processes designed to break down deposits.
  2. Specialized Cleaning Chemicals: Once the large contaminants are removed, the heat exchanger components are disassembled and immersed or flushed with custom-formulated chemicals. These solutions dissolve residual deposits and scale, which reduces heat-transfer efficiency.
  3. Thorough Flushing: The system is flushed to remove dissolved contaminants, ensuring the exchanger is clean and free of residual debris.
